All About Lungs
The lungs are made up of a left and right lung. The left lung has 2 separate area called lobes and the right lung has 3 lobes. The reason the left only has 2 lobes is because the heart is on the left side. The average adult breathes about 6.0 liters of air per minute and this supplies enough oxygen and removes enough carbon dioxide to keep the adult healthy. The lungs have cilia or little hair like structures to help keep secretions move up in the lungs so the secretions can be coughed out of the lungs. If we keep the secretions in our lungs then we can’t get the air in and out of our lungs and the lungs can pick up infections because the secretions aren’t removed.
